"Commentaries on Living" by Jiddu Krishnamurti is a profound exploration of human existence, delving into the complexities of daily life, relationships, and the mind's intricacies. Through a collection of dialogues, observations, and reflections, Krishnamurti addresses topics like fear, desire, conflict, and the pursuit of truth. He challenges conventional thinking, urging readers to observe life without judgment, embrace self-awareness, and understand the nature of the self. The book invites a deep inward journey, encouraging readers to transcend societal conditioning and discover the beauty of living in the present moment. Krishnamurti's timeless insights provide a path to inner freedom, harmony, and authentic living.
